Understanding the Mechanics of the Ascent
At its core, this exhilarating game operates on a provably fair random number generator (RNG). This ensures that each flight is independent and unbiased, providing players with confidence in the integrity of the game. The plane's ascent isn’t predetermined; instead, it’s governed by an algorithm that dynamically adjusts its trajectory. Initially, the climb is generally slow, offering players a comfortable window to assess the situation and potentially increase their bet. However, as altitude increases, so does the volatility. The rate of ascent can accelerate dramatically, and the risk of a crash heightens substantially. It's this unpredictable nature that creates the heart-stopping tension that players actively seek.

Strategies for Navigating the Volatility
Various strategies have emerged within the player community, each designed to improve the odds of success. One popular tactic is the “Martingale” system, where players double their bet after each loss, aiming to recover previous losses with a single win. This is, however, a high-risk strategy that requires a substantial bankroll and can quickly lead to significant losses if a losing streak persists. Another common approach is to set automatic cash-out points, allowing the player to secure profits at a predetermined multiplier without relying on manual intervention. This is particularly useful for players who find it difficult to remain calm under pressure. A more conservative strategy involves consistently cashing out at lower multipliers, prioritizing smaller but more frequent wins over the pursuit of larger, riskier payouts. Ultimately, the best strategy depends on the player’s risk tolerance and financial goals.
Bankroll Management: The Cornerstone of Success
Regardless of the chosen strategy, effective bankroll management is paramount. Players should only wager a small percentage of their total funds on each bet, ensuring that they have sufficient capital to withstand losing streaks. A common guideline is to limit bets to 1-5% of the total bankroll. It's also crucial to avoid chasing losses, a common pitfall that can lead to reckless betting and significant financial setbacks. Treating the game as a form of entertainment, rather than a source of income, is a healthy mindset that can help players avoid emotional decision-making and remain disciplined in their approach. Remember, responsible gambling is key to enjoying the excitement of this game without suffering undue financial stress.
